Job Title: AEP & RTCDP Implementation Specialist

Location: Remote

Rate -Open
Experience: 2–3+ years in AEP/RTCDP | 5+ years in digital data platforms



Job Summary:

We’re looking for a hands-on Adobe Experience Platform (AEP) & Real-Time CDP Specialist with end-to-end implementation experience—from data ingestion using connectors, SDKs, and APIs to XDM schema creation, profile unification, audience segmentation, and activation.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Ingest data via AEP connectors, SDKs, and custom APIs

  • Define and map data to XDM schemas

  • Configure and manage Unified Profiles & identity stitching

  • Build audience segments and activate to destinations

  • Analyze and refine segments using Customer Journey Analytics (CJA)

  • Share best practices and guide cross-functional teams


Requirements:

  • 2–3+ years hands-on AEP/RTCDP experience

  • Strong with XDM, SDKs, audience building, identity resolution

  • Experience using CJA for measurement & optimization

  • Adobe certifications a plus

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
